HEAVENLY STEAK IN SLOW COOKER
Heavenly steak, sirloin, mushrooms and onions topped with Cheddar in coconut cream in slow cooker for 3 hours and served on fettuccine. Perfect comfort food. The men loved it and did not even mind that I used the braai meat for this.
- 1 kg sirloin steak or steak of choice cut into 1.5 cm thick pieces or as prefered
- 2 onions sliced
- 1 packet mushrooms, chopped
- cake flour with spices
Mix flour with spices of your choice and roll the steak into the mixture, shaking off the extra flour.
In the slow cooker pot, pack layers with meat, onions and mushroom.
- Sauce:
- 200 ml milk
- 1 can coconut cream
- 1 tablespoon worcestershire sauce
- 1 tablespoon chutney
- 1 tablespoon tomato sauce
- 1 package white onion soup powder
- 1 cup grated cheese
Now mix the following except the cheese.
Warm up the sauce ingredients before pouring over meat in slow cooker as coconut cream is solid when you scoop it out of the tin.
Sprinkle grated cheese on top and cover with the lid.
Put slow cooker for 3 hours on HIGH.
It worked perfectly, I served it on pasta.
